Canady-Durden Cemetery
Canady-Durden Cemetery is a cemetery in Emanuel, Georgia. Canady-Durden Cemetery is situated nearby to the lake Little Pond, as well as near the reservoir Hudson Lake.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Twin City and Swainsboro.
Twin City
Village
Twin City, formerly known as Graymont, is a city in Emanuel County, Georgia, United States. As of the 2020 census, the city had a population of 1,642. Twin City is situated 6 miles southeast of Canady-Durden Cemetery.
